The Hypertension Score in 49735, Gaylord, Michigan is 20 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

82.22 percent of the population in 49735 drive to work alone. 0.59 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 80.24 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 4.88 percent of the residents in 49735 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.79 members with about 2.07 cars available per household.

An estimate of 91.83 percent of the residents in 49735 has some form of health insurance. 40.77 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 70.24 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 49735 would have to travel an average of 21.91 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Munson Healthcare Grayling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 49735, Gaylord, Michigan.

As of , an estimate of 20,402 residents live in 49735 with a median age of 44.2 years. 21.02 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 21.39 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 38.47 percent of the residents in 49735 is currently married, and 21.16 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 49735 is $6,413.17.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 49735 is approximately $846. The median household spends about 13.19 percent of their income on housing.

Hypertension, also known as high blood pressure, is a common condition that affects many individuals in the United States. It is a chronic medical condition characterized by elevated blood pressure in the arteries, which can lead to serious health complications such as heart disease, stroke, and kidney failure if left untreated.
